How Clean Is Our Water?

My students need a Qualitative Introduction to Water Pollution Kit and a LaMotte Leaf Pack Experiments Stream Ecology Kit.

My Students

My students, who range in age from ninth through twelfth grade,take water for granted. I teach high school science in a small, poor, rural county in North Carolina. Even though their lives and their families' livelihoods depend on water they are clueless about its fragility and stewardship.

As often as three times in a year there are notices posted at the school water fountains informing the public that the water treatment plant has failed to meet some federal drinking water standard.

When the kids ask what that means, all I can do is explain it and show them lists of chemicals tested for and what the guidelines are. I can't show them how sampling is done, how tests are performed, what is good testing procedure and what isn't, or the experience of actual field work. I know that some of what I describe to them 'goes in'. But with literally NO money from the county to spend on science supplies for the last three years, there is no way we can provide the opportunity for these kids to internalize the importance of watershed and water-supply protection. They are lucky to live in a place where there is abundant water but they need to learn about the dangers facing our water resources and how to detect those dangers.

My Project

We need a water pollution sampling kit and a stream sampling kit. With this equipment the students can test the streams emptying into the water supply lake, the lake itself and the tap water. They can follow the path of pollutants downstream to the kitchen table or upstream to the source. They can learn so much about the fragility of the groundwater supply and the environment that both generates and protects it. They can become informed citizens and consumers. Using the stream sampling kit they will see what macroinvertebrates live in the stream. They will learn that the types of macroinvertebrates they find indicate the health of the stream. Your help will make it possible for my students to learn why water stewardship is vital in our communities.

Without your support this project cannot take place.

There are no funds to purchase these resources. But with your kind donation my students will become the stewards of our environment that we want them to be.
